In the great spirit world
I just hang in the moment
flush with a reason
to mimic and fly
together we dance
and embrace the great
ocean
that holds us
its bubbles seem oxygen shy
my partner is here with me
a coming together
another soul enters
what was our embrace
we glide close together
embracing each other
sensitive silence
subjective control
in the vast ocean
I found true devotion
the notion
of sharing
the great space
together
a sentient pairing
Inspired by my lovely friend Kim Copeland
